    Came here for brunch. They were fairly packed for a weekday but we managed to find a table right away. The place is clean and the staff is pretty efficient. We ordered a lavender mimosa, avocado toast, and proscuitto crepe. Lavender Mimosa- Sweet and refreshing! The flavor doesn't exactly remind me of lavender but it's delicious on its own right. Avocado Toast- The bread base is yummy and toasted perfectly. The avocado was generously spread and had a good flavor. Topped a good amount of greens and tomatoes. Perfect for those who want to keep it healthy! Proscuitto Crepe- The crepe base was a lovely combination of chewy and crisp. They loaded it with filling which is a mixture of proscuitto, arugula, tomatoes, and cheese. The savory meat is complemented well bu the greens and cheese. Served with a side of fruit to cleanse the palate. A pretty filling dish! Great place for a casual breakfast!

    Do you offer gluten-free? Your sister's location via Yelp states they offer gluten-free. I would like to know beforehand. Thank you in advance.

    Hello! Yes we offer gluten free crepes! So any sweet or savory crepe can be made with our gluten free crepe batch!
